Saffron chili paste shrimp
Servings: 2
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: around 5 minutes
Rating: 0.0 / 5 (0 votes)

Ingredients

  • 12 large cooked shrimp
  • 1 tablespoon sambal oelek(chili paste)
  • 1/8 teaspoon saffron
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ract, imitation, no alcohol
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 12 large kalamata olives
  • 1/4 cup water

Instructions

Sauté in olive oil the shrimp for a few minutes. Add the vanilla and cook for around one minute. Add the water and add the saffron. Cook for one minute. Add the olives at the end. Serve. Sourdough toast is nice to serve along with this dish.
